  3. In this lecture, Professor Kagan describes the aftermath of the Thirty Years Peace. He argues that the Peace had the potential to keep peace between Athens and Sparta due to the arbitration clause. In addition, he argues that during this time, Athens sends various diplomatic messages to the wider Greek world stating their intentions for peace, such as the Panhellenic venture to establish Thurii.   4. Dell explains the culture and dynamics of Dell, Inc. during its early years. The company was run by hardworking, versatile people who were action-orientated and willing to listen. Many of those early employees went on to fill important positions at the company later on.   7. In this lecture, Professor Kagan describes the growth of a new power: Thebes. Under the leadership of Epaminondas and Pelopidas, Thebes grows into a major power among the Greek cities. In fact, the Thebans even rout the Spartans in a standard hoplite battle in the battle of Leuctra.   9. Neeleman talks about how he tells his employees a simple formula for success: Show up to work, on time, with a good attitude. Take care of your fellow workers. If you set that expectation level, and are consistent, and model the behavior you expect, the employees then model it for each other, he adds. Neeleman also tells the story of the Southwest pilots who were fired for flying naked in the cockpit.

  12. For a venture capital firm, the time they choose to invest in a company is important. At Mayfield Fund, Roberts explains, they either like to come in early and get a reasonable ownership of the company or take the less risky path of entering at a later stage. However, it is hard to invest in a middle stage deal where money requirements are higher and the concept has not yet been proven.
